Robert R. Parsons, 87, of Shippensburg, passed away Friday, June 10, 2016 at the Chambersburg Hospital.
He was born Friday, April 5, 1929 in Burnt Cabins, Fulton County. Robert was a son of the late Aubrey and Annie Jaymes Parsons.
He retired in 1984 from the Radio Section at Letterkenny Army Depot, after over 34 years of service. Robert was a United States Army Veteran of the Korean War, serving with the First Calvary Division. He was a member of the Shippensburg Fish & Game Assoc., Fort Morris Chapter AARP, Oscar M. Hykes American Legion Post # 223, Durff-Kuhn VFW Post # 6168, and the Minnequa Social Club all in Shippensburg, and the AMVETS Post # 224, Chambersburg. Robert enjoyed being a gunsmith and target shooting.
He is survived by his wife of 65 years, Kathryn Fleck Parsons whom he married March 24, 1951 in Columbia, SC, and numerous nieces and nephews.
In addition to his parents he was preceded in death by two sisters, Grace & Marie Parsons, three brothers, Homer, Kenneth, & Foster Parsons.
